Protected method c#
Webb6 apr. 2024 · protected :この型またはメンバーには、同じ class 内のコードか、その class から派生した class 内のコードからのみアクセスできます。 internal :この型またはメンバーには、同じアセンブリ内の任意のコードからアクセスできますが、別のアセンブリからはアクセスできません。 つまり、 internal の型またはメンバーには、同じコンパイル … Webb10 juli 2024 · As for the protected methods, it’s a bit more complex: var myClass = new Mock (); myClass.Object.CallingProtectedMethod(); myClass.Protected().Verify("ProtectedMethod", Times.Once()); The Mock object must be transformed to an IProtectedMock object, by calling Protected () on it.
Protected method c#
Did you know?
Webb21 maj 2024 · 1. The protected modifier means that only the class itself or a subclass can access Shoot. You are trying to access it from some other class Test that has no … WebbC# : Is there any difference regarding performance of private, protected, public and internal methods in C# classes?To Access My Live Chat Page, On Google, S...
Webb15 sep. 2024 · The private protected keyword combination is a member access modifier. A private protected member is accessible by types derived from the containing class, but … Webb29 sep. 2024 · C# Language Specification See also Use the access modifiers, public, protected, internal, or private, to specify one of the following declared accessibility levels …
Webb18 nov. 2016 · [TestMethod] public void Confirm_Text_test () { Mock testViewModel= new Mock (null, null, null); testViewModel.Protected () .Setup ("ConfirmText") .Returns ("Ok") .Verifiable (); testViewModel.Verify (); } I understand that with the above example I have only setup, and assert, not acted upon it.
Webb13 feb. 2024 · A method is a code block that contains a series of statements. A program causes the statements to be executed by calling the method and specifying any required method arguments. In C#, every executed instruction is performed in the context of a method. The Main method is the entry point for every C# application and it's called by …
WebbMember data should in general always be private or protected, unless you have a good reason for it not to be so. My rationale for putting public methods at the top is that it defines the interface for your class, so anyone perusing your header file should be able to see this information immediately. jenny andrews princethorpeWebb6 apr. 2024 · C# class Point { protected int x; protected int y; } class DerivedPoint: Point { static void Main() { var dpoint = new DerivedPoint (); // Direct access to protected members. dpoint.x = 10; dpoint.y = 15; Console.WriteLine ($"x = {dpoint.x}, y = {dpoint.y}"); } } // Output: x = 10, y = 15 jenny anderson theater mariettaWebb6 apr. 2024 · C# class Point { protected int x; protected int y; } class DerivedPoint: Point { static void Main() { var dpoint = new DerivedPoint (); // Direct access to protected … pacemaker crtpWebbProtected Modifiers in C# In c#, we can use the protected modifier to specify that the access is limited to the containing type. Also, we can use it for the types derived from … jenny and wendy pet competitionWebb14 maj 2012 · protected Change SetupApproval (string changeDescription) { Change change = Change.GetInstance (); change.Description = changeDescription; change.DateOfChange = DateTime.Now; change.MadeBy = Common.ActiveDirectory.GetUsersFullName (AccessCheck.CurrentUser ()); … pacemaker ctA protected member is accessible within its class and by derived class instances. For a comparison of protected with the other access modifiers, see Accessibility Levels. Example 1. A protected member of a base class is accessible in a derived class only if the access occurs through the derived class type. Visa mer A protected member of a base class is accessible in a derived class only if the access occurs through the derived class type. For example, consider the following code segment: The … Visa mer For more information, see Declared accessibility in the C# Language Specification. The language specification is the definitive source for C# syntax and usage. Visa mer In this example, the class DerivedPoint is derived from Point. Therefore, you can access the protected members of the base class directly from the derived class. If you change the … Visa mer pacemaker crtdWebb24 mars 2014 · I have a protected method in base class : public class BaseClass { protected virtual void Foo () {} } The method is overrided one of the derived classes: … jenny ann thilmany